Master of the revels
Revel Rev"el, n. [OF. revel rebellion, disorder, feast, sport. See Revel, v. i.] A feast with loose and noisy jollity; riotous festivity or merrymaking; a carousal. This day in mirth and revel to dispend. --Chaucer. Some men ruin . . . their bodies by incessant revels. --Rambler. Master of the revels, Revel master. Same as Lord of misrule, under Lord.
